La Liga appoints Hill+Knowlton Strategies

Comms agency to help grow Spanish league's presence in Africa.

17 January 2018 Elena Holmes

La Liga, which operates the top two divisions of Spanish club soccer, has appointed Hill+Knowlton Strategies (H+K) to help grow the presence of Spanish soccer in Africa.

The communications agency will use its Nigerian office in the city of Lagos to focus on public relations strategy, media and influencer engagements with La Liga ambassadors, and communications and relationship-building activities including local partnerships and brand activations.

La Liga also has offices based in Nigeria and South Africa as part of its international network.

“The aim of the La Liga global communications team is to build the organisation’s reputation, and expand awareness of its football clubs beyond Real Madrid and FC Barcelona,” said Joris Elvers, global communications director for La Liga. “H+K’s strong media relations and knowledge of the market will help capture the passion, drama and suspense of La Liga’s football.”

Tokunboh George-Taylor, managing director of H+K Nigeria, added: “We hope to increase La Liga’s share of voice and present the league as not just a football league, but as an entertainment spectacle, whilst also highlighting the organisation’s commitment to social responsibility and fair play.”
